Business Summary

KRAQ Krakacquisition is a shell company formed to pursue a merger, acquisition, or similar business combination. As a blank-check entity, it does not currently operate a traditional business but seeks to create value by acquiring an existing private company.

AI Exposure / Tech Reliance

As a shell company, KRAQ does not appear to have direct operating exposure to AI or proprietary technology at this stage. Any future AI or technology reliance would depend on the business it ultimately acquires or merges with.

The Bull Case

With a $425 million market cap and no current earnings, the company may offer optionality tied to a potential future acquisition. If management completes a compelling transaction, shareholders could benefit from re-rating as the business transitions from a shell structure to an operating company.

The Bear Case

The absence of earnings and lack of forward EPS growth beyond $0.00 highlight the uncertainty surrounding near-term value creation. Without an identified operating business, investors face execution risk and limited financial transparency.
